Abstract
The utility model relates to a jewelry product. The jewelry article comprises a decorative component comprised of a base and a replaceable decorative element. The base is made in the form of a body having a cavity, and the magnet at the middle portion thereof is fixed in an elongated shape, forming two spaces along the long sides thereof. Meanwhile, the replaceable decorative element includes a base plate in the form of a metal plate for the magnet of an elongated shape. The technical result achieved in jewelry making is that the replacement of the decorative element is recommended without the use of auxiliary tools.
Description
Technical Field
The jewelry industry utility model sample, which relates to the design of jewelry, can replace decorative inserts.
Background
Known ornaments have at least one replaceable ornamental element comprising a base, a seat connected to the at least one ornamental element, wherein at least one through hole is formed at the base, and each ornamental element has a leg hingeably connected thereto, and when the leg and the hinge are formed, it is possible to pass through the through hole of the base and rotate the axis of the leg and/or the hinge, and then fix the hinge to the base (see RU 2243711C1, published 1/10 2005).
Known ornaments are provided with at least one annular segment and at least one hollow part with a removable ornamental element, shaped so as to fit snugly on a portion of the annular segment, with the tool being set on two opposite walls of said hollow part, in said portion of the ring segment being made radially from its thickness a radial groove made circumferentially so as to form a groove approximately in the form of the letter L, a single elastically deformable element being mounted on the lower surface of the ring segment and being arranged to lock the ornamental element in position on the ring segment after the rod has been introduced at the bottom of the L-letter shaped groove (see RU 2185766C2, published 7/27/2002).
A disadvantage of these analogues is the complexity of the construction of the decoration, as a result of which the replacement of the decorative element is more complicated and therefore the complexity of its manufacture. The complication is that the fastening means are mechanical fastening means consisting of several elements, and that a considerable number of operations must be performed with the fastening means in order to replace the decorative element.
A known jewelry item consisting of a base (1), in the wall (3) of its lower part (2), a hole (7) for a button; a magnet (5) located within the base (1); an intermediate element (8) on which the lower surface of the decorative element (12) is located; at least partially made of a metal that is sensitive to magnetic fields (see EP0113316(a1), published in 1984-07-11).
A drawback of the analogous is the complexity of completing its structure, resulting in complexity of its production and insufficient rigidity and strength of the decorative element.
The closest technical nature is a frame-containing jewelry item comprising a recessed central portion, a decorative element having a form for positioning inside said recessed portion of said frame, a first magnet attached to a lower portion of the decorative element, at least one other magnet attached and located within said recessed portion of the frame for securing said decorative element to said frame, and an open frame through the bottom of said recessed portion providing access for contact pins to select movement of said decorative element from said frame (see US2002112322(a1), published as 2002-08-22).
The closest counterpart has the disadvantage that it is difficult to extract the decorative element, which can only be achieved with the aid of an auxiliary tool.
SUMMERY OF THE UTILITY MODEL
The utility model aims to manufacture a reliable simple jewelry product, and jewelry can be manually replaced.
The technical result achieved in the jewellery production is that the replacement of the decorative element is recommended without the use of auxiliary tools, while having the stability of the magnetized decorative element.
The jewelry item according to the present invention, comprising a decorative part consisting of a base and a replaceable decorative element, characterized in that said base is made in the form of a body with a cavity, in the middle part of which magnets are fixed in elongated shape, forming two spaces along its long edges, while the replaceable decorative element contains a base plate in the form of a metal plate for the elongated shaped magnets. The jewelry comprises a decorative part consisting of a base made in the form of a body with a cavity, in the middle of which a magnet of elongated shape is fixed, forming two spaces along its long sides, and an interchangeable decorative element containing a base plate in the form of a metal plate for magnetization into an elongated magnet.
A base in the form of a hollow shell, in the middle part of which the magnet is fixed with an elongated shape forming two spaces along its long sides, the space being usable on one side on its long sides to press the decorative element so that a part of it is below the level of an ellipse, so that the opposite part of it rises above the height of the body, can be easily picked up and removed with the fingers, i.e. using the principle of oscillation, where the ellipse magnet performs the function of a support point. On the other hand, there is no space on the short side, thus ensuring the stability of the magnetic decoration element, and the principle of oscillation on the short side of the elongated magnet cannot be applied, thus preventing an unintended movement of the decoration element.
In one embodiment, the compartment having the oval shaped magnet affixed thereto is formed by parallel walls.
In order to reliably and stably fasten in the housing cavity of the elongated magnet, the portion formed by the parallel walls is made. This structural design increases the strength of the product. Also when the removable decorative element is tilted and absorbs loads therefrom, the parallel walls act as support points, protecting the magnets from damaging effects.
In one embodiment, the depth of the cavity is greater than the height of the magnet.
The depth of the body cavity should be greater than the height of the elongated magnet in order to protect the side walls of the ornamental element. The decorative elements are nearly aligned with only the upper portion protruding.

Detailed Description
The jewelry item comprises a decorative part 1 consisting of a base 2 made in the form of a body 4 with a cavity 5 and a replaceable decorative element 3, in the middle part of which magnets 6 are elongated to form two spaces 7 along its long sides, while the decorative element comprises a base plate 8 in the form of a metal plate and a magnet of elongated shape. The compartment consists of a rectangular magnet fixed to its parallel walls 9. The depth of the cavity is greater than the height of the elongated magnet.
Noble metals, such as gold, silver, platinum, can be used in the manufacture of the trim part. Other metals may also be used: cupronickel, german silver, brass, copper, tin, steel, aluminum, copper-zinc alloy, titanium, tin-lead, bronze, zinc, nickel.
In the manufacture of the replaceable decorative element, precious stones, inferior precious stones, colored stones, organic stones, such as amber, pearl, nacre, coal jade, coral, mottled colored stones may be used. The replaceable decorative element may also be made of metal, such as gold, silver, platinum, cupronickel, german silver, brass, copper, tin, steel, aluminum, copper-zinc alloy, titanium, tin-lead, bronze, zinc, nickel. Materials which can be used as decorative elements are enamels, leather, wood, bone, epoxy, murano glass, clay polymers, ceramics, plastics, rubber, textiles, designer paper.
The above materials may also be combined in the manufacture of the decorative element. In this case, the decorative element can be made, for example, of metal, with an insert of stone or other decorative material: steel, enamel-bearing inserts; silver, stone-bearing inserts, and the like.
To add decorative effects and to designate the manufacturer to apply an engraving or uv stamp on the base or on the removable composite link decorative element. Also, to enhance the decorative effect, additional decorative elements may be mounted on the base.
The claimed jewelry item functions as follows.
The magnetic attachment of the mount and the interchangeable ornamental element ensures that they are securely bonded to form the ornamental portion of the gemstone. If it is desired to change the appearance of the declared article, the user clicks on either of the two edges of the interchangeable decorative element, there being a space beneath the two edges. Due to the shape of the magnet, the space formed between the elongated magnet (e.g., 1 millimeter high) and the body wall allows the edge of the interchangeable decorative element applying the force to sink into one of them. The other, opposite edge, in contrast, rises above the base using the oscillation principle, wherein the edge or parallel walls of the magnet (in the case of their additional presence) act as support points. The user then picks up the raised edge with the fingers and pulls out the replaceable decorative element for replacement.
